Actual sales volume for a period is 5,000 units. budgeted sales volume is 4,500. actual selling price per unit is $15 and budget price per unit is $15. 75. the sales price variance is $3,750

Sales Price Variance:

The term "sales price variation" describes the discrepancy between a company's anticipated price for a good or service and the amount that was actually paid for it.

Reduced competition, higher sales price realization, general inflation, a sudden rise in product demand, etc. are a few potential reasons for a favorable sales price variance.

Sales Price Variance = (Actual Sale Price – Standard Sale Price) × Actual Quantity Sold.

Calculation of the Sales Price Variance :-

Sales Price Variance = ( Actual price - Budgeted price)× Actual quantity

Sales Price Variance = ( $15 - $15.75) * 5,000

Sales Price Variance = $3,750 Unfavorable.
